What is the adjective for caramelize?

What's the adjective for caramelize? Here's the word you're looking for.

Included below are past participle and present participle forms for the verbs caramel and caramelise which may be used as adjectives within certain contexts.

caramelly
  1. Resembling or characteristic of caramel.
  2. Examples:
    1. “Given the right setting, a chunk of caramelly aged Gouda might welcome a chaser of dark chocolate.”
      “This espresso is made with less than the usual hot water for a highly intense shot that highlights espresso's caramelly sweetness.”
      “The high ratio of brown sugar to white results in a deep caramelly flavor, which goes wonderfully with the pistachios and dried apricots.”
